Things to Do in South Africa’s Major Cities This Festive Season

Here are some suggestions from Intouch Relocations to keep you and your family busy over the holidays:

Johannesburg

  • The Lipizzaner Christmas Performances taking place until 23 December 2016 in Kyalami. The magnificent white stallions dance to a mix of classical music and Christmas carols. Santa will make an appearance and the children will be involved in the performance. Shows are at 10:30am, 3pm and 7pm on selected days. Tickets are R160.   • Magical Moonlight Christmas Market at the Bryanston Organic Market on Tuesday evening, the 20th December 2016 from 5pm until 9pm. The market will be lit up with sparkling lights and trimmings, offering an array of uniquely hand-crafted gifts and Christmas decorations.
  • Sandton City’s Festive Line-up for The Kids will keep the kids entertained, while you sneak in some Christmas shopping. Dora & Friends, the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les and Paw Patrol will be performing live. Other activities include two giant Lego areas, face painting and the Toy Kingdom train, as well as the opportunity to get a photo with Santa on his sleigh.

Cape Town

  • New Year’s Eve Concert at Kirstenbosch. Performances by Johnny Clegg and Slow Jack beneath the starry night skies on scenic open lawns of Kirstenbosch Botanical Gardens. Bring along blankets, picnic baskets and bubbly, and usher in 2017 in laidback style. All ages welcome. Tickets are R375 per person from www.webtickets.co.za
  • Kirstenbosch Carols by Candlelight takes place in the Kirstenbosch Botanical Gardens between the 15th and 18th of December. Children of all ages are welcome. Ticket prices range from R25p/p to R85p/p for children, while adults pay between R100p/p and R110p/p depending on the night selected.   • Ceres Steam Train is an old world experience on board an authentic vintage steam train to Ceres. The trip starts and ends outside Royal Cape Yacht Club, Dock Road, Cape Town on second and fourth Saturday of every month at 7.30am to 6.30pm (26 Nov, 10, 17 & 31 Dec, 7, 14 & 28 Jan, 11 & 25 Feb).   • Christmas Twilight Market at Blaauklippen. Take a summer’s evening stroll through the Blaauwklippen marketplace filled with goodies, Christmas gifts and pop-up wine sales on Blaauwklippen products. Expect a wide range of delectable cuisine as well as crazy cocktails, with the usual array of Christmas cakes, mince pies, pancakes, ice-cream, arts, crafts and antiques. There is entertainment every evening by a wide range of talented musicians and Carols by Candlelight for visitors to join in while supporting some local charities through donations of the candle sales. Ample activities for kids and maybe even be a visit from Santa. Taking place from the 16th to the 20th December from 4pm to 10pm at Blaauwklippen Wine Estate, Strand Rd, R44 Stellenbosch.
